About the course

This honours degree combines electronics and communications engineering, building capability in analogue and digital circuit design and the development of communication systems and networks. You’ll study core engineering science, digital signal processing, radio, fibre-optic and microwave communications, networking, and cellular/wireless technologies, with strong practical problem solving, teamwork and project work. This is a Bachelor Degree / Honours Degree in Engineering – Electrical.

Career outcome

Graduates are prepared for professional practice across electronics and communications engineering, applying skills in circuit and system design, signal processing and modern wired and wireless communications. Typical work spans telecommunications and networking, radio and microwave systems, fibre optics, embedded and digital hardware, and technology project delivery in industry and government.
